They are secure
Upvc windows offer a solid barrier against vandals and intruders. Upvc windows are energy-efficient and easy to maintain. Window alarms can be added to improve security for your upvc windows.
Windows are one of the main entry points to any building, therefore security is an important factor to take into consideration. It is also essential to select windows that are made from a durable material. UPVC is a well-known choice. This material is waterproof, resistant and highly resistant to corrosion. It is also available in a range of colours.
One of the great advantages of UPVC is its capability to be reinforced by other materials. By adding galvanised steel or aluminium to the hollow body will increase the strength of the uPVC window or door frame. This makes for a strong extremely durable piece of uPVC that doesn't require painting.
Beading is yet another feature of uPVC windows. Beading requires a thin piece of material affixed to the glass pane. These beading processes are either plastic, metal or wood.
A great way to increase the security of windows is to use uPVC beads. Burglars are less likely enter windows that have been equipped with beading.
One of the best ways to increase the security of a uPVC window is to install the sash-jammer. The jamming device will stop burglars from opening the window.
To increase security, a lot of uPVC windows come with multi-locking systems. Multi-locking locks secure windows at different points around the sash.
Security can be further enhanced by adding anti-snap locks. Anti-snap locks are designed to keep the barrel from snapping.
The most secure security is due to the material employed. uPVC is a high-quality tough polymer that is extremely tough. Secured by Design or Secured by Design Kit marks are good alternatives for uPVC windows.
If you are planning to replace your current uPVC windows with newer ones, make sure they are compliant with PAS 24 2016. These standards will improve the security of your home, by ensuring that the windows you choose to install are compliant with these standards.
They are adaptable
UPVC windows can be put to any style of home due to their versatility. It is durable and safe, making it a great option for homes. They also can add value to a home. You can purchase uPVC windows online, or contract a company to install them.
A UPVc repair can be an ideal option if have a window with an unfinished frame. The material is simple to work with and can be fixed to be a match to the original finish.
Weather can cause damage to windows' exterior. The inside of a window should be taken care of. The sash can easily be cleaned with the aid of a vacuum cleaner. Changes to the hardware can assist in protecting your windows made of UPVc.
To change the handle, remove the two screws on the base of the handle. This will let you install the new handle. There are a variety of handles that are available. Pick a handle that is compatible with the style of your window and your Espag locks.
Window handles that are replaced can be simple to install. Make sure that the direction of the espag lock matches exactly. Also, consider the distance from the back of the window. It is a good idea for aluminum windows to have a a step height of 21mm, and uPVC windows 9mm.
Cockspur handles are typically found on older frames. These handles are typically attached with three to four screws. Professional window installers can complete the measuring for you.
Cadenza replacement handles for upvc windows are more rigid and are more difficult to locate. They are more difficult to find and less flexible. Make sure that the handle you purchase is the same height as the existing window.
